<p><b>Liberty Stadium</b> is a sports stadium and conferencing venue located in the <a href="/pages/w/111932825490122">Landore</a> area of <a href="/pages/w/105583199476121">Swansea</a>, <a href="/pages/w/109625922390490">Wales</a>. The stadium is all-seated. It has a capacity of 20,750, making it the largest purpose-built venue in Swansea. It is the home stadium of <a href="/pages/w/108326559192405">Premier League</a> club <a href="/pages/w/109098382442123">Swansea City</a> and the <a href="/pages/w/109766705709211">Ospreys</a>. As a result of Swansea City's promotion, the stadium became the first <a href="/pages/w/108326559192405">Premier League</a> ground in Wales. The Liberty Stadium has the second smallest capacity of the 20 stadia in the Premier League for the 2014/15 season after <a href="/pages/w/109521835741025">Loftus Road</a>. It is the <a href="/pages/w/138004102895622">third largest stadium in Wales</a> – after <a href="/pages/w/112028222143519">Millennium Stadium</a> and <a href="/pages/w/102280339825246">Cardiff City Stadium</a>. In European competition the stadium is known as Swansea Stadium due to advertising rights.</p><h2>History</h2><p>With the <a href="/pages/w/103094073078973">Vetch Field</a>, <a href="/pages/w/123335167710751">St Helen's</a> and <a href="/pages/w/129718907070164">The Gnoll</a> no longer being up-to-date venues to play at, and both the Swans and the Ospreys not having the necessary capital to invest into a new stadium, <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/City_and_County_of_Swansea_council" class="wikipedia">Swansea council</a> and a developer-led consortia submitted a proposal for a sustainable 'bowl' venue for 20,520 seats on a site to the west of the <a href="/pages/w/102918259749271">River Tawe</a> on the site of the <a href="/pages/w/127127193997687">Morfa Stadium</a>, an <a href="/pages/w/110896632293439">athletics stadium</a> owned by the <a href="/pages/w/114749328536125">City and County of Swansea</a> council. It was funded by a 355,000 ft retail park on land to the east of the river. The final value of the development being in excess of £50m.</p>
